Purified!

Every flower must grow through dirt. – Anon 

The genealogy of Jesus includes a woman who tricked her father-in-law into sleeping with her (Tamar) and a prostitute (Rahab). Amen! 

In truth, all of us have some “dirt” in our lives that God can and will use for His glory. We grow best through pain and adversity for they serve to strengthen our resolve and focus when we fully understand God’s purposes. Since sin entered the world, God has been in the process of ‘purifying’ us. He knows where we’ve been, what we’ve been up to, and what we need to become His, and He openly confesses His love for us. May we not be ashamed to confess HIM today.

Gracious Love for All

Those who deserve love the least, need it the most. – Anon 

Matthew and Zacchaeus. Tax collectors hated and despised by their own people. Yet Jesus counted them among his ‘friends.’ Hmm! 

At any given moment most of us could possibly think of someone who we would deem as unworthy of any grace or love (murderers/killers, terrorists, enemies, vagrants, etc.). But in reality, we too are never really deserving of God’s love, but yet he extends it freely to all. And his love knows no bounds or limits and covers a multitude of sins – OURS. Acceptance of the gift doesn’t make us better than the next person, it just makes us aware of our own needs. God wants everyone to know of his love and has given us the honor and privilege of sharing it. As you face the day remember his love knows no color or circumstances it cannot touch.
